ANECDOTE

Boromir's Final Heroic Stand

  • Boromir's final stand was tragic and heroic as he fought off orcs despite fatal wounds.
  • His last act was protecting the hobbits, seeking redemption by defending the weak with his life.

INSIGHT

Pride Rooted in Leadership

  • Boromir's pride stems from his lifelong leadership and military success, not arrogance.
  • He firmly believes in courage and strength as keys to defeating evil, shaped by limited exposure to other powers.
